    Roof Lanterns and Skylights

    Light Up Your Life with Roof Lanterns

    Roof lanterns, or roof lights, are an impressive architectural feature, adding a certain wow-factor to your property. Unlike skylights, roof lanterns aren’t flush with the roofline. Instead, they protrude from the flat roof, creating a spectacular, three-dimensional feature that is bound to turn heads.

    In the context of light ingress, roof lanterns are in a league of their own. Thanks to their multi-faceted design, roof lanterns can capture light from various angles, bathing your interior in sunlight all day long.

    Furthermore, roof lanterns can add an architectural aesthetic, amplifying your property’s character. If you’re looking to create a focal point or enhance the visual impact of your flat roof in Dorset and Poole, a roof lantern might be the way forward.

    However, roof lanterns often require a larger budget than skylights, both for the product itself and for installation. Plus, their prominent design may not be suitable for every property.

    Skylights vs Roof Lanterns: Making the Right Choice

    Choosing between skylights and roof lanterns for your flat roofs comes down to your preferences, requirements, and budget.

    If you’re after a sleek, minimalistic design that blends seamlessly with your flat roof, a skylight would be a fitting choice. It offers a subtle yet effective way to boost natural light and ventilation in your home.

    On the other hand, if you’re seeking to make a bold architectural statement and maximise light ingress, a roof lantern could be the answer. Keep in mind, though, this may come at a higher cost.

    No matter what you choose, both options are fantastic ways to brighten up your home in Dorset and Poole, harnessing the power of natural light to transform your living space.
